Predictor de smith

Post on 25-Jul-2015

913 views 0 download

Transcript of Predictor de smith

Discusión del problema Discusión del problema de retardos de tiempo en de retardos de tiempo en

controlcontrol

Discusión del problema Discusión del problema de retardos de tiempo en de retardos de tiempo en

controlcontrol

Universidad Técnica Federico Santa MaríaDepartamento de ElectrónicaAutomatización Industrial

Universidad Técnica Federico Santa MaríaDepartamento de ElectrónicaAutomatización Industrial

Profesor: Jaime Glaria

Ayudante:Daniel Erraz

Alumno: Andrés Cisternas

Profesor: Jaime Glaria

Ayudante:Daniel Erraz

Alumno: Andrés Cisternas

Esquema a ver:Esquema a ver:

Problemas Problemas caracteristicoscaracteristicos

Aproximación de PadéAproximación de Padé Predictor de SmithPredictor de Smith

Esquema a ver:Esquema a ver:

Problemas Problemas caracteristicoscaracteristicos

Aproximación de PadéAproximación de Padé Predictor de SmithPredictor de Smith

Problemas Problemas caracteristicoscaracteristicos

Problemas Problemas caracteristicoscaracteristicos

Un simple Molino de ruedas, con un retardo de: s/v Un simple Molino de ruedas, con un retardo de: s/v segundos.segundos.

Un simple Molino de ruedas, con un retardo de: s/v Un simple Molino de ruedas, con un retardo de: s/v segundos.segundos.

Cloración del aguaCloración del agua Cloración del aguaCloración del agua

Sistema de

cloración

Sistema de

cloración

Sistema de

medición

Sistema de

medición

cañeríacañería

dd

El proceso tiene operaciones de transporte de fluidos a lo largo de distancias considerables (cañerías largas entre unidades, por ejemplo);

El proceso presenta fases de incubación (lag en sistemas biológicos, por ejemplo);

Los sensores (o alguno de ellos) requieren plazos extensos para arrojar una medición (cromatógrafos, por ejemplo);

El actuador requiere de un tiempo importante para producir un cambio (válvulas muy pesadas, por

ejemplo)

El proceso tiene operaciones de transporte de fluidos a lo largo de distancias considerables (cañerías largas entre unidades, por ejemplo);

El proceso presenta fases de incubación (lag en sistemas biológicos, por ejemplo);

Los sensores (o alguno de ellos) requieren plazos extensos para arrojar una medición (cromatógrafos, por ejemplo);

El actuador requiere de un tiempo importante para producir un cambio (válvulas muy pesadas, por

ejemplo)

Lo anterior produce que en el Lo anterior produce que en el controlador:controlador:

Lo anterior produce que en el Lo anterior produce que en el controlador:controlador:

Las perturbaciones no se detectan oportunamente;

La acción de control, que depende de la oportuna medición, no ocurre en el momento adecuado;

El lazo cerrado puede resultar inestable.

Las perturbaciones no se detectan oportunamente;

La acción de control, que depende de la oportuna medición, no ocurre en el momento adecuado;

El lazo cerrado puede resultar inestable.

Aproximación de Aproximación de PadéPadé

Aproximación de Aproximación de PadéPadé

Universidad Técnica Federico Santa MaríaDepartamento de ElectrónicaAutomatización Industrial

Padé de 1Padé de 1erer orden:orden:

Padé de 1Padé de 1erer orden:orden:

21

21

ST

ST

e ST

21

21

ST

ST

e ST

Padé es una aproximación de la Padé es una aproximación de la función exponencial para dejarla función exponencial para dejarla en forma mas manejable en forma mas manejable (racional).(racional).

Padé es una aproximación de la Padé es una aproximación de la función exponencial para dejarla función exponencial para dejarla en forma mas manejable en forma mas manejable (racional).(racional).

...!22

21

...!22

21

2

2

STST

STST

e ST

...!22

21

...!22

21

2

2

STST

STST

e ST

Para una aproximación mas Para una aproximación mas exacta (en la fase) se usa:exacta (en la fase) se usa:Para una aproximación mas Para una aproximación mas exacta (en la fase) se usa:exacta (en la fase) se usa:

Limitaciones: n<10Limitaciones: n<10Limitaciones: n<10Limitaciones: n<10

Ejemplo: Ejemplo: Control de velocidad de giro de un motor Control de velocidad de giro de un motor hidráulico hidráulico

Ejemplo: Ejemplo: Control de velocidad de giro de un motor Control de velocidad de giro de un motor hidráulico hidráulico

0)19000()110()(

:

))(10)(100(

)(10·2)()·(

:

)1.01)(01.01(

20)()·(

42000220223

2

24

TTT

T

T

ST

ssssp

ticoCaracterísPolinomio

sss

ssHsG

Padé

ess

sHsG

0)19000()110()(

:

))(10)(100(

)(10·2)()·(

:

)1.01)(01.01(

20)()·(

42000220223

2

24

TTT

T

T

ST

ssssp

ticoCaracterísPolinomio

sss

ssHsG

Padé

ess

sHsG

3

2

4200022022

10·37.60

0:

110

)19000()110(

:

T

mcondición

ssm

Routh

T

TTT

3

2

4200022022

10·37.60

0:

110

)19000()110(

:

T

mcondición

ssm

Routh

T

TTT

Aplicando condiciones de Aplicando condiciones de estabilidad:estabilidad:Aplicando condiciones de Aplicando condiciones de estabilidad:estabilidad:

Predictor de SmithPredictor de SmithPredictor de SmithPredictor de Smith

Universidad Técnica Federico Santa MaríaDepartamento de ElectrónicaAutomatización Industrial

El objetivo es sacar el retardo El objetivo es sacar el retardo fuera del lazo de control.fuera del lazo de control.

El objetivo es sacar el retardo El objetivo es sacar el retardo fuera del lazo de control.fuera del lazo de control.

Para ello se deben cumplir ciertos supuestos:

Se consta con un modelo que representa exactamente a la

planta.

Su retardo es exactamente conocido y constante.

Para ello se deben cumplir ciertos supuestos:

Se consta con un modelo que representa exactamente a la

planta.

Su retardo es exactamente conocido y constante.

En que consiste?En que consiste?En que consiste?En que consiste?

Proceso

Smith propone agregar una compensación Smith propone agregar una compensación del tiempo muerto, antes que la señal del tiempo muerto, antes que la señal medida llegue al controlador:medida llegue al controlador:

Smith propone agregar una compensación Smith propone agregar una compensación del tiempo muerto, antes que la señal del tiempo muerto, antes que la señal medida llegue al controlador:medida llegue al controlador:

Por algebra de bloques el modelo Por algebra de bloques el modelo se reduce a:se reduce a:Por algebra de bloques el modelo Por algebra de bloques el modelo se reduce a:se reduce a:

Se debe tener un modelo exacto de Se debe tener un modelo exacto de la planta (función de transferencia) la planta (función de transferencia) y de su tiempo de retardo (ty de su tiempo de retardo (tdd cte.) cte.)

Sensible a perturbaciones.Sensible a perturbaciones. El modelo matemático de un El modelo matemático de un

Predictor de Smith es normalmente Predictor de Smith es normalmente implementado digitalmente, ya que implementado digitalmente, ya que el retardo es difícil de construir en el retardo es difícil de construir en forma analoga.forma analoga.

Se debe tener un modelo exacto de Se debe tener un modelo exacto de la planta (función de transferencia) la planta (función de transferencia) y de su tiempo de retardo (ty de su tiempo de retardo (tdd cte.) cte.)

Sensible a perturbaciones.Sensible a perturbaciones. El modelo matemático de un El modelo matemático de un

Predictor de Smith es normalmente Predictor de Smith es normalmente implementado digitalmente, ya que implementado digitalmente, ya que el retardo es difícil de construir en el retardo es difícil de construir en forma analoga.forma analoga.

Problemas:Problemas:Problemas:Problemas:

GRACIAS POR SU GRACIAS POR SU ATENCIÓNATENCIÓN

GRACIAS POR SU GRACIAS POR SU ATENCIÓNATENCIÓN